Commit Graph
81 Commits
Author SHA1 Message Date
Ross McFarland 8ed7278032 DynProvider and DnsimpleProvider ALIAS tests 2017-06-03 17:21:08 -07:00
Ross McFarland 11cf155477 Pass of ALIAS support across supported providers. Allow ALIAS ttl
Supports ALIAS for Dnsimple, Dyn, Ns1, and PowerDNS. Notes added to readme about
some of the quirks found while working with them. TTL seems to mostly be
accepted on ALIAS records so it has been added back, what it means seems to vary
across providers, thus notes.
2017-06-03 09:44:05 -07:00
Ross McFarland 82ed633669 Merge remote-tracking branch 'origin/master' into alias-support 2017-06-03 09:31:07 -07:00
Ross McFarland 756f017854 Go back to simple/standard ALIAS value 2017-06-03 08:47:01 -07:00
Ross McFarland 703ec00e24 Merge pull request #50 from vanbroup/patch-1
Fix NS1 provider name
2017-06-01 07:30:07 -07:00
Paul van Brouwershaven ac82ab171e Fix NS1 provider name
Update example class name from "octodns.provider.nsone.Ns1Provider" to working "octodns.provider.ns1.Ns1Provider".
2017-06-01 15:57:53 +02:00
Ross McFarland 68fe90fd78 Merge pull request #48 from weyrick/patch-1
Update README to include new NS1 Provider
2017-05-31 09:53:12 -07:00
Shannon Weyrick 7163c83102 Update README to include new NS1 Provider 2017-05-31 12:29:02 -04:00
Ross McFarland b549ee79e9 Merge pull request #33 from github/nsone-basic-support
First pass through NsOneProvider
2017-05-30 07:57:24 -07:00
Ross McFarland 9dbfe7c839 AliasValue, name & type, improved Record KeyError handling 2017-05-28 17:05:23 -07:00
Ross McFarland f2b3e9e3f4 Add missing class 2017-05-28 07:26:47 -07:00
Ross McFarland 9e172ed303 Add AliasRecord & tests 2017-05-28 07:21:53 -07:00
Ross McFarland f12bbd9191 Merge pull request #44 from github/cmd-mains
Add __main__ calls to main in cmds
2017-05-27 14:12:36 -07:00
Ross McFarland 9da976122c Add __main__ calls to main in cmds 2017-05-27 14:10:32 -07:00
Ross McFarland ea653c7c2a Merge pull request #42 from clwells/doc-link-fix
Fixing octodns/record.py link
2017-05-24 13:37:39 -07:00
Chris Wells b1e762dee8 Fixing octodns/record.py link 2017-05-24 16:33:44 -04:00
Joe Williams 68fcd69f22 Merge pull request #40 from github/failsafe
use a percentage of change/deleted records rather than an absolute count
2017-05-24 08:32:05 -07:00
Joe Williams e16bd2701f fix up logging 2017-05-24 08:04:52 -07:00
Joe Williams 5b93bb5979 use a percentage of change/deleted records rather than an absolute count 2017-05-24 07:21:04 -07:00
Ross McFarland bc1736bc39 NS1, add Delete support, fix apply create, flush out tests to 100% 2017-05-23 09:36:15 -07:00
Ross McFarland 06e17d043b Corrected handling of ns1 errors, Ns1Provider.populate tests 2017-05-22 17:33:31 -07:00
Ross McFarland 2ff34997a5 Merge pull request #35 from github/dyn-monitor-user-agent
Dyn monitor user agent
2017-05-12 05:39:37 -07:00
Ross McFarland 864a700f95 Remove extranious u's 2017-05-11 08:45:25 -07:00
Ross McFarland 1aae060f6d Add User-Agent header to Dyn monitors 2017-05-11 08:43:49 -07:00
Ross McFarland 23257d8ac7 NsOneProvider -> Ns1Provider and related renames 2017-05-10 16:09:21 -07:00
Ross McFarland 5f95cd904c First pass through NsOneProvider 2017-05-09 22:17:52 -07:00
Ross McFarland a6948a3b0b Merge pull request #32 from github/route53-geo-conv-fixes
Route53 geo conv fixes
2017-05-09 16:42:41 -07:00
Ross McFarland 852381b810 Add test for Route53Provider geo -> plain conversion 2017-05-09 14:45:35 -07:00
Ross McFarland d7469cbd0b Test _get_health_check_id without perm to create 2017-05-09 14:26:48 -07:00
Ross McFarland ee6a654054 HealthCheckId is required for geo records now 2017-05-09 14:22:39 -07:00
Ross McFarland e7fffb0ca1 Route53Provider correctly handle converting to and from geo records 2017-05-09 14:20:44 -07:00
Ross McFarland 1f01c55826 Merge pull request #29 from zBart/cloudflare-semicolons
Handle Cloudflare not escaping semicolons
2017-05-03 06:25:08 -07:00
Ross McFarland e41f0d7d78 Wrap a long line in test_octodns_provider_cloudflare.py 2017-05-03 06:24:37 -07:00
zBart bc98af024b Handle Cloudflare not escaping semicolons 2017-05-03 12:46:42 +02:00
Ross McFarland faa4630362 Merge pull request #21 from The-Compiler/patch-1
readme: Fix link to contributing doc
2017-04-28 19:05:33 -04:00
Ross McFarland cedfd57b3b Merge pull request #20 from endersonmaia/patch-1
Fixed broken link to Records Documentation
2017-04-28 19:04:23 -04:00
Ross McFarland 753586693c Merge pull request #19 from LeoColomb/patch-1
readme: typos and bad links
2017-04-28 19:04:00 -04:00
Ross McFarland cad07ff57c DnsimpleProvider rather than DNSimple 2017-04-28 19:02:54 -04:00
Florian Bruhin d64e9da1c2 readme: Fix link to contributing doc 2017-04-27 18:59:04 +02:00
Enderson Tadeu S. Maia 01f60e2d70 Fixed broken link to Records Documentation 2017-04-27 13:58:16 -03:00
Léo Colombaro be0d25e31c readme: typos and bad links
Fixes typos in the Supported providers table
2017-04-27 18:43:08 +02:00
Ross McFarland d84f30c14d Merge pull request #18 from github/dist-and-rel
Fixes to get a working sdist build
2017-04-18 09:18:53 -07:00
Ross McFarland 5a742bca92 Fixes to get a working dist build 2017-04-18 09:12:14 -07:00
Ross McFarland ea376d7d07 Merge pull request #17 from github/supported-providers-readme
Supported providers readme
2017-04-18 08:52:11 -07:00
Ross McFarland f68213647f Add missing header col 2017-04-18 08:51:33 -07:00
Ross McFarland 274b679f9e Add a supported providers table to the README 2017-04-18 08:50:05 -07:00
Ross McFarland 437badd41d Merge pull request #16 from github/dyn-td-province-fix
DynProvider Traffic Directors want lowercase province without country
2017-04-13 13:27:38 -07:00
Ross McFarland 20351ba442 DynProvider Traffic Directors want lowercase province without country 2017-04-13 08:43:02 -07:00
Ross McFarland 08d8009b14 Merge pull request #15 from github/logo
Add the octoDNS logo
2017-04-12 15:31:50 -07:00
Ross McFarland a0d4c9800f Add the octoDNS logo 2017-04-12 15:30:52 -07:00